| The valves are shut off but water continues to flow from the emitters and/or sprinklers. |
| A small rock or other debris has made its way into the valve diaphragm. |
| Call for service. |
| The landscape lights are not working. |
| The transformer is not plugged into an electrical outlet. The GFI was tripped on the outlet. |
| Plug the transformer in and set the time to turn on and off at desired times. Reset the outlet by pressing the test button then the reset. |
| The light bulb is burned out. There is not a good connection between the light and the wire. |
| Replace the light bulb. Open the connector and reconnect to the wire firmly in another area. |
The sprinklers are not spraying where they should be. |
| Adjust the arc nozzle by twisting at the top of the sprinkler. |
| Foot traffic or the lawn mower bumps the sprinkler head. |
| Water has stopped flowing from a drip emitter. |
| Small debris is clogging the emitter. Hard water deposits can restrict the flow of water. |
| Replace emitter. Remove the emitter and dislodge the debris by blowing into it or flushing water through it. |
| The timer has stopped working and the yard is no longer being watered. |
| The timer was reset by an electrical surge. |
| Program the timer based the current season. Use the drip and sprinkler guidelines we provided you as a starting point. |
